Considering window tinting for your car? Before you make a decision, it's crucial to ask the right questions to ensure a seamless and satisfying experience. In this blog, I'll guide you through the five essential questions you should ask before tinting your car windows.
 

Legalities and Regulations:

Before diving into the world of car window tinting, it's imperative to research and understand the local laws and regulations regarding window tinting in your area. Different regions have specific rules regarding the darkness of tint allowed on various windows. Knowing these regulations ensures that you comply with the law and avoid potential fines or legal complications.

Type of Tint Material:

Not all window tints are created equal. It's crucial to consider the type of tint material that will best suit your needs and preferences. There are various options, including dyed, metalized, carbon, and ceramic films, each offering unique benefits such as heat reduction, UV protection, and privacy. Understanding the characteristics of each type will help you make an informed decision based on your specific requirements.

Installation Professionalism:

The quality of the tint installation is as important as the choice of tint itself. Research and choose a reputable professional or service provider with a proven track record in window tinting. A poorly installed tint can lead to bubbling, peeling, or discoloration, diminishing both the aesthetic appeal and functionality of the tint. Look for reviews, ask for recommendations, and ensure the installer has the necessary certifications.

Expected Maintenance and Longevity:

Window tinting is an investment, and it's essential to understand the maintenance requirements and expected lifespan of the chosen tint. Different tint materials have varying durability, and external factors such as climate, sun exposure, and driving conditions can affect the longevity of the tint. Knowing how to care for your tint properly will extend its lifespan and maintain its effectiveness over time.

Warranty Coverage:

Before committing to a window tint, carefully review the warranty offered by the manufacturer or installer. A solid warranty not only reflects the confidence of the provider in their product but also offers you protection in case of unexpected issues. Understand the terms and conditions of the warranty, including coverage for issues like fading, peeling, or bubbling. This information will give you peace of mind and assurance in the durability and quality of your chosen window tint.
